How many ions are in ag2so4?

two ions
In silver(I) sulfate, the silver ion has a +1 charge, and there are two ions of silver for every one sulfate ion. Its chemical formula is Ag2 SO4. Silver(I) sulfate is white.

Is silver a sulfate?

Silver sulfate has two forms. Both of them have one sulfate ion, SO4 -2. Silver(I) is Ag+1 and silver(II) is Ag+2. Ionic compounds have to be electrically neutral so the quantity of silver ions in the bond with the sulfate is determined by its charge.

How do you make agso4?

The synthesis of silver(II) sulfate (AgSO4) with a divalent silver ion instead of a monovalent silver ion was first reported in 2010 by adding sulfuric acid to silver(II) fluoride (HF escapes). It is a black solid that decomposes exothermally at 120 °C with evolution of oxygen and the formation of the pyrosulfate.

Does silver sulphate dissolve in water?

Silver sulfate is the inorganic compound with the formula Ag2SO4….Silver sulfate.

Names
Solubility in water 0.57 g/100 mL (0 °C) 0.69 g/100 mL (10 °C) 0.83 g/100 mL (25 °C) 0.96 g/100 mL (40 °C) 1.33 g/100 mL (100 °C)
